Creamy Cucumber Cilantro Salad (Vegan)

Ingredients

• 4 medium cucumbers (about 600g), diced
• 2 medium tomatoes (about 250g), chopped
• 1/2 medium red onion (about 75g), finely diced
• 1 cup (240g) plain, unsweetened soy yogurt
• 1 tablespoon (15ml) fresh lemon juice
• 2 tablespoons (about 8g) fresh cilantro, chopped
• Salt and freshly ground black pepper, to taste

Instructions

1. In a large mixing bowl, combine the diced cucumbers, chopped tomatoes, and finely diced red onion.
2. In a separate small bowl, whisk together the plain soy yogurt, fresh lemon juice, and chopped cilantro until smooth.
3. Pour the yogurt dressing over the vegetable mixture. Season with salt and pepper, then toss gently until everything is evenly coated.
4. Cover the bowl and refrigerate for at least 2 hours. This chilling time is crucial for the flavors to meld and deepen.
5. Stir the salad again just before serving to redistribute the dressing. Enjoy chilled.

Pro Tips

• For a less watery salad, slice the cucumbers in half lengthwise and use a spoon to scoop out the seeds before dicing.
• Use a thick, Greek-style plain soy or coconut yogurt for the creamiest possible dressing. Always choose an unsweetened variety.
• The flavors deepen beautifully overnight, making this a fantastic make-ahead dish for parties or meal prep. It’s best enjoyed within 2 days.

FAQ

Q: Can I use a different dairy-free yogurt for this salad
A: Absolutely! While the recipe calls for plain soy yogurt, a thick, unsweetened coconut or almond-based yogurt would also work beautifully. For the best creamy texture, look for a Greek-style dairy-free yogurt.

Q: How can I add more protein to make this a complete vegetarian meal
A: To make this salad a more substantial meal, consider adding a can of rinsed and drained chickpeas or some crumbled firm tofu. Both options will boost the protein content without overpowering the fresh flavors of the salad.

Q: How long does this creamy cucumber salad last in the fridge
A: This salad is best enjoyed within 2 days. While the flavors meld beautifully overnight, the cucumbers will release water over time, making the dressing thinner. For best results, store it in an airtight container in the refrigerator.

Q: What can I substitute for cilantro in this recipe
A: If you’re not a fan of cilantro, fresh dill or parsley are excellent substitutes. Both herbs pair wonderfully with cucumber and the tangy yogurt dressing, offering a different but equally refreshing flavor profile.
